Artemide Tolomeo Desk Lamp.
Located in Nantwich, GB
This Artemide Tolomeo dest lamp was designed by both Michele De Lucchi and Giancarlo Fassina in 1987 as a reinterpretation of the lighting used in factories during the age of industrialism.The Artemide Tolomeo is both flexible and functional and is one of the worlds most iconic designs. The combination of the cantilevered arm and weighted base ensures smooth movement and a precise distribution of light. The light can be adjusted and the structure holds stable in every position. The Tolomeo has won various design awards including the IF Product Design Award, the Red Dot Design Award and the prestigious Compasso dOro.

20th Century Grey Italian Artemide Table Lamp, Desk Light by Riccardo Blumer
Located in West Palm Beach, FL
A grey, vintage Mid-Century Modern Italian table lamp made of hand crafted brushed aluminum, designed by Riccardo Blumer and produced by Artemide, featuring a one light socket in good condition. This desk light is a discontinued model, the base has still the original label. The wires have been renewed. Wear consistent with age and use. circa 1960, Italy. Measures: Base: 0.5" H x 8.5" W x 8.5" D Shade: 2.75" H x 4.5" W 5" D Riccardo Blumer is an Italian designer, architect, professor and a choreographer born in 1959, in Bergamo, Italy. Blumer graduated from the Polytechnic University of Milan, the largest technical university in Italy. In 1966, he designed laleggera for Alias, which won the ADI Compasso d’Oro in 1998. Since 2006, Blumer works at the University of San Marino, Italy. Artemide is an Italian design-oriented manufacturer, founded in 1960 in Pregnana Milanese, Italy by the Italian engineer Ernesto Gismondi. The company Artemide is well-known for their excellent design, for example the Tizio desk lamp...
